Hatem-Roy honored for 40 years of service during annual employee recognition event
March 26, 2024

We gathered last week to celebrate the accomplishments of nearly 60 employees during our annual Years of Service Awards. Staff ranging from 10 to 40 years of service were honored by Board President Mike Rurak and with moving tributes read by their managers.

This special tradition included our CEO Joan Hatem-Roy, LICSW, at left, who marked her 40th anniversary with the agency.

Chief Human Resources Officer Shelley DeSimone shared heartfelt praise and highlighted Joan’s career at the agency, which began right out of college. Early in her career, Joan was our first Protective Services Caseworker and was instrumental in developing our social work licensing program, which was ultimately adapted statewide.

Joan has brought AgeSpan to many heights during her time as an agency leader. Among her accomplishments, Joan spearheaded AgeSpan’s integration into the health care arena, negotiated a first-in-the-nation contract to deliver a self-care program with managed care, and introduced and advanced culturally sensitive nutrition services and other health equity initiatives to improve access to our communities.

Since stepping into the role of CEO in 2017, Joan has led the agency through the 2018 natural gas explosions; a merger; the pandemic, and a rebranding initiative. Through the years, she has developed a national reputation as an innovator, thought leader, and source of technical assistance and encouragement to other organizations around the country. In 2021, she received the national Excellence in Leadership Award by USAging.

“She is a supportive and inclusive leader,” Shelley noted, “All with an eye to making sure our consumers get the best services possible and that this is a great place to work.”

In response, Joan brought it all back to our employees and what makes AgeSpan such a special place: “I have an amazing staff. It’s always been so wonderful to work with all you,” she said. “Even when challenges come our way, we figure it out together. I’m so lucky.”
